Supported MediaImage file formats (IdClassification.MediaImage - Media images to store disk (and partition) images)

  • All entries in table below are supported for file format identification.
  • 'X' in "Text" column indicates text extraction is supported for the file format.
  • 'X**' in "Text" column indicates text extraction is supported BUT binary-to-text filtering is used on partially parsed document records.
  • 'X' in "Metadata" column indicates metadata extraction is supported for the file format.
  • 'X' in "EmbeddedItem" column indicates embedded item/attachment extraction is supported for the file format.
  • 'X' in "ContentHash" column indicates a content hash is supported for the file format (see MD5ContentHash and SHA1ContentHash)

If a file format does not have a supported content extractor that extracts text then, optionally (default), a binary-to-text content extractor will be used to extract UTF-8, UTF-16, Windows-1252, and ASCII from the binary. In many cases, indexable text can be extract from unknown document formats.
